    What is Diabetes Mellitus?

    So, let's start with the basics. Diabetes mellitus is a chronic metabolic disorder. Basically, it means your body has trouble processing sugar (glucose). Glucose is the main source of energy for your body, but it needs insulin to get into your cells. Insulin is a hormone made by your pancreas. If your body doesn't make enough insulin, or if your cells don't respond to insulin properly, glucose builds up in your blood. That's high blood sugar, or hyperglycemia, which can lead to all sorts of health problems down the road. There are different types of diabetes, the most common being type 1 and type 2. In type 1 diabetes, your body's immune system attacks and destroys the insulin-producing cells in the pancreas. This means the body produces little to no insulin. Type 2 diabetes, on the other hand, is when your body doesn't use insulin well (insulin resistance), and eventually, it can't make enough insulin to keep your blood sugar normal. Other types include gestational diabetes, which happens during pregnancy, and rarer forms caused by other conditions or medications.     Type 1 Diabetes: A Case Study

    Let’s look at a case study focusing on type 1 diabetes. This patient is a 25-year-old male who has recently been diagnosed with type 1 diabetes. The patient started experiencing classic symptoms such as increased thirst (polydipsia), frequent urination (polyuria), and unexplained weight loss. After visiting his doctor, blood tests revealed a very high blood glucose level, and further tests confirmed the absence of insulin production. The doctor immediately started him on insulin therapy, showing him how to inject insulin and how to monitor his blood sugar using a glucometer.

    Symptoms and Diagnosis

    In this particular case, the patient's symptoms were classic. Increased thirst, frequent urination, and weight loss are red flags for hyperglycemia, which is the hallmark of diabetes. These symptoms are caused by the body trying to get rid of excess glucose. The kidneys work overtime to filter out glucose, which pulls water along with it, leading to frequent urination. This also causes dehydration, which leads to increased thirst. The weight loss happens because the body can't use glucose for energy, so it starts burning fat and muscle. His diagnosis involved several steps. First, his doctor did a simple blood glucose test, which revealed a high blood sugar level. Next, they likely performed an A1c test (a measure of average blood sugar over the past 2-3 months) to confirm the diagnosis and to rule out type 2 diabetes. Finally, they tested for autoantibodies to confirm that the immune system was attacking the insulin-producing cells. This is what classifies type 1 diabetes. These tests are standard practice, but the details in this specific case are a great example to remind us that diagnosis isn't just about reading numbers; it’s about understanding the whole person and their health history.

    Treatment and Management

    Treatment for type 1 diabetes always involves insulin, which is essential because the body doesn't produce it. This patient was started on a multiple daily injection (MDI) regimen, which means he'd inject insulin several times a day to match his meal times and blood sugar levels. They probably taught him to count carbohydrates to determine how much insulin to take with each meal. Education is a huge part of treatment. The patient needs to understand how to monitor his blood sugar with a glucometer, how to adjust his insulin dose based on his blood sugar levels and carb intake, and how to recognize and treat any problems like hypoglycemia (low blood sugar) or hyperglycemia (high blood sugar). Regular check-ups with his doctor and a diabetes educator are critical for monitoring his progress, adjusting his treatment plan as needed, and managing any complications. The patient’s lifestyle will also be a major part of this treatment plan. He will need to develop an active lifestyle, and he will need to change his eating habits.

    Type 2 Diabetes: A Case Study

    Now, let's explore a case study involving a 60-year-old woman with type 2 diabetes. She was diagnosed after a routine check-up. She had no obvious symptoms, but her doctor noticed high blood sugar levels. She had a family history of diabetes and was slightly overweight. She was initially prescribed lifestyle modifications and an oral medication to help improve her insulin sensitivity.

    Symptoms and Risk Factors

    Unlike type 1 diabetes, type 2 can sometimes be asymptomatic in its early stages. This patient did not experience any immediate symptoms. Risk factors for this patient included her family history of diabetes and her weight. These are huge warning signs. Genetics and lifestyle are the two major players in type 2 diabetes. Family history tells us that there's a genetic predisposition, and being overweight often leads to insulin resistance. This means the body's cells don't respond well to insulin, so glucose builds up in the blood. Other risk factors include age, ethnicity, and a sedentary lifestyle. The lack of symptoms at the time of diagnosis makes regular check-ups and screenings so important.

    Treatment and Management

    Her initial treatment included lifestyle changes: diet and exercise. This can dramatically improve insulin sensitivity. The doctor recommended that she eat a balanced diet with controlled carbohydrate intake and also told her to start regular exercise, like walking, for at least 30 minutes a day. She was also prescribed an oral medication to help improve her insulin sensitivity and to reduce glucose production in the liver. A common medication is metformin. She was taught how to monitor her blood sugar and how to recognize the signs of any complications, such as hypoglycemia or hyperglycemia. Regular follow-up appointments with her doctor and a diabetes educator would allow for her medication to be adjusted as needed and for any problems to be addressed. Over time, many patients with type 2 diabetes may require other medications, or eventually insulin, to maintain good blood sugar control.

    Gestational Diabetes: A Case Study

    Lastly, let's look at gestational diabetes. This happens when diabetes develops during pregnancy in a woman who didn't previously have diabetes. Imagine a 30-year-old woman in her third trimester of pregnancy. She undergoes routine glucose screening and is diagnosed with gestational diabetes. This is a common situation.

    Symptoms and Diagnosis

    Often, gestational diabetes doesn't have noticeable symptoms, so screening is super important. High blood sugar during pregnancy can cause complications for both the mother and the baby, which is why routine screening is standard practice. The diagnosis involves a glucose challenge test, followed by a glucose tolerance test if the first test is abnormal. These tests measure how well the body processes glucose, and they can determine if the woman has gestational diabetes. The earlier the diagnosis, the better. Early detection can help prevent complications, such as a large baby, and can reduce the risk of future health problems for both mother and child.

    Treatment and Management

    Treatment primarily focuses on lifestyle modifications, particularly diet. The woman is instructed to follow a meal plan that controls carbohydrate intake and promotes balanced nutrition. Regular exercise, such as walking, is also recommended to help control blood sugar levels. In some cases, medication, such as insulin, is needed to manage blood sugar levels if lifestyle changes aren't enough. Regular monitoring of blood sugar levels is important to ensure that blood sugar levels are within the normal range. After delivery, the gestational diabetes usually disappears. But these women are at a higher risk of developing type 2 diabetes later in life, so they need to be vigilant about their health. The key here is early detection and proactive management, which helps to ensure a healthy pregnancy and a healthy outcome for both mother and baby.
